Solution for 3y-(5+y)=-2(y+8)+3 equation:


3y-(5+y)=-2(y+8)+3

We simplify the equation to the form, which is simple to understand
3y-(5+y)=-2(y+8)+3

Remove unnecessary parentheses
3y-5-1y=-2*(y+8)+3

Reorder the terms in parentheses
3y-5-1y=+(-2y-16)+3

Remove unnecessary parentheses
+3y-5-1y=-2y-16+3

We move all terms containing y to the left and all other terms to the right.
+3y-1y+2y=-16+3+5

We simplify left and right side of the equation.
+4y=-8

We divide both sides of the equation by 4 to get y.
y=-2
